Deploy step 6 — Bounceward processor. Drain the ingest queue, confirm zero in-flight bounces, then push the new build to the Harbor node. Smoke test with the synthetic bounce fixture before re-enabling ingest. Rollback is a single image pin revert. The pipeline needs the deploy key to push; it is the one below.

release key, kawif-hawep: bky13_X7TGuRG4Zu4ZJ

## Account Recovery — Trailnote Offline Mode

When a surveyor's Trailnote app has been offline for 30+ days, their local credentials expire and sync refuses to resume. Don't make them wipe the device — all their unsynced field data lives there! Instead, open the support console, pick "Offline Reinstate," and enter their handle. The console will ask for the support team's shared recovery passphrase before issuing a reinstatement token. Use the one below.

unlock words, bagaf-fajeg: zorael-kelax-fraath-quenix-eliok-sileth-aldmir-wenir-druiel

Symptom: release smoke tests intermittently fail with NXDOMAIN for internal service names, typically during the first ten minutes after a deploy. Cause: the node-local resolver cache occasionally serves stale negative entries after pods are rescheduled. Mitigation: rerun the smoke suite once; if failures persist, flush the resolver cache on affected nodes using the standard script — do not restart the cluster DNS service during a release window. The flush procedure and escalation criteria are documented here:

wiki page, fajof-tajef: https://vault.tolvaqio.corp/board/pipeline/pages/ticket/c20d7f984bcc9e12

For heads of department. The six-store pilot with the Fennick's chain ran twelve weeks across the Calder Vale region. Gross margin on piloted lines came in at 31%, two points above forecast. Logistics costs exceeded plan by 8%, driven by split deliveries; consolidation from the Harlowe depot would close most of the gap. Fennick's has signalled interest in extending to twenty stores. A decision paper goes to the executive committee next month. The confidential planning note is appended below.

internal memo for fawef-tafof: Headcount on the Holath team goes from 48 to 102 by the end of January. Gross margin on Holath came in at 5 percent against a plan of 36 percent.